DESCRIPTION
The K3020P/, 3020PG series consists of a photo-transistor
optically coupled to a gallium arsenide infrared-emitting
diode in a 6-lead plastic dual inline package
VDE STANDARDS
These couplers perform safety functions according to the
following equipment standards:
• DIN EN 60747-5-5 (VDE 0884)
• IEC 60950/EN 60950
• VDE 0804
• IEC 60065
AGENCY APPROVALS
• UL1577, file no. E76222 system code C, double protection
• BSI: BS EN 41003, BS EN 60065 (BS 415), BS EN 60950
• DIN EN 60747-5-5 (VDE 0884)
• FIMKO (SETI): EN 60950, certificate no. 12398
